Abstract
The invention discloses a kind of track crane DC power-supply system and methods, system includes operation track crane in orbit, direct current of ground power supply unit, slide device and current-collector, direct current of ground power supply unit includes transformer and rectifier, its output is connected to slide device, current-collector is installed on track crane, current-collector passes through brush contact slide device, the direct current supply of direct current of ground power supply unit output, through slide device, brush and current-collector supply track crane, to realize the mobile DC power supply to track crane, compared to the mode of existing cable reel power supply, it simplifies power supply structure and improves Supply Security, extend service life, it is high to solve existing track crane power supply system maintenance cost, the short technical problem of service life;And by track crane job instruction distribute rationally and the utilization again of the feedback energy so that track crane DC power-supply system energy conservation and operating cost have advantage.

Background technique
Current automation track crane mostly uses traditional power supply mode of high-tension cable reel.
Reel power supply mode is exchange autonomous power supply system, and every track crane is powered by AC power source, and is equipped with independent
Transformation, rectification, inversion system, although every set transformation, arrangement, the small in size of inversion system, price are low, cable drum need with
Track crane keeps high-speed synchronous operation, this is relatively high to the performance requirement of the control system of reel operation, and hose coiling mechanism starts
And rotary inertia is big when acceleration and deceleration, big to the impact of high-tension cable, hose coiling mechanism, reduction gearbox, acutely, service life is short for abrasion;
Hose coiling mechanism speed reducer, slip ring box etc. need periodic maintenance and replacement accessory, and a whole set of hose coiling mechanism maintenance is big, general coil of cable
For the service life of disk (including high-tension cable) at 5 years or so, the operation of high-tension cable reel later period, maintenance cost were huge.

Specific embodiment
The specific embodiment of the application is described in more detail with reference to the accompanying drawing.
The track crane DC power-supply system that the application proposes, including running track crane 12 in orbit, direct current of ground supplies
Electric installation 13, slide device 14 and current-collector 15;Direct current of ground power supply unit 13 includes transformer 131 and rectifier 132, defeated
It is connected to slide device 14 out;Current-collector 15 is installed on track crane 13;Current-collector 15 connects slide device 14, and passes through brush
(not shown) and 11 sliding contact of guide rail;Direct current of ground power supply unit 13 is by the alternating current of power grid after transformation, arrangement
Direct current supply is exported, the direct current supply of output supplies track crane 12 through slide device 14, brush and current-collector 15, realizes to rail
Hang 12 direct current supply in road.
Direct current of ground power supply unit 13 is installed on ground, and a set of direct current of ground power supply unit can supply for more track cranes
Electricity;The DC power-supply system of entire Container Yard can be divided into the track crane DC power-supply system that multiple the application propose;Example
Such as, it is contemplated that the power of the range of direct current supply and ground power supply this, each track crane DC power-supply system is 4 heap blocks
10 track crane power supplies of 8 track crane power supplies or 5 heap blocks are preferred.
Current-collector 15 is hung on track crane 12 by the way that fixed structure (such as steel construction of channel steel production) is overhanging, follows rail
Road hangs 12 and moves together, by the contact of brush and slide device 14, by electric energy directly from direct current of ground power supply unit conduct to
Track crane, to realize the mobile power supply of track crane.
Above-mentioned track crane DC power-supply system is alleviated compared to the prior art by the way of cable drum power supply
The main screw lift of track crane, simplified structure and the direct current supply mode for moving to ground make the reliability of direct current supply effective
It improves, reduces later period system maintenance cost, increase service life;
In the embodiment of the present application, as shown in Fig. 2, slide device 14 includes wiping bracket 141 and setting or is opened in wiping bracket
On wiping guide rail 142;The output of direct current of ground power supply unit 13 is connect with wiping guide rail 142;Current-collector 15 is connect by brush
Touch wiping guide rail 142.In, for the supply voltage drop for reducing wiping guide rail, direct current is selected to power on a little in whole wiping guide rail
Middle position, that is, the DC low-voltage cable connection drawn from direct current of ground power supply unit is to the middle position of wiping guide rail.
As a preferred embodiment, the wiping bracket 141 that the application proposes is T-type bracket;The two of T-type wiping bracket
End is respectively arranged with wiping guide rail.For example, the direct current supply of 4 heap blocks adjacent in Container Yard is mentioned by a application
Direct current of ground power supply unit out provides, and each heap block configures two track cranes, and direct current of ground power supply unit is arranged in adjacent 4
T-type wiping bracket is installed in the middle position of a heap block in the channel among two heap blocks, every T-type wiping bracket two sides
Wiping guide rail gives the track crane of two sides heap block to power respectively.
Based on the track crane direct current supply framework that the application proposes, existing cable drum power supply mode is compared, is also changed
The modes of original track crane fiber optic communications, therefore, the communication dress for including in the track crane DC power-supply system that the application proposes
It sets, or to be as shown in Figure 2, for the communication wiping guide rail 143 being set on wiping bracket, alternatively, the system is using wireless
Communication device, including the second communication dress for being installed on the first communication device of direct current of ground power supply unit and being installed on track crane
It sets, the transmission of data, signal is realized based on wireless communication mode.
Preferably, waveguide feed is used in the first communication device and the second communication device;Waveguide has shielding
The high advantage of energy, so that communication signal is able to maintain higher signal-to-noise ratio in transmission process, it is possible to prevente effectively from co-channel interference
And the external interferences such as radar signal, while using real-time (RT) communication mechanism, system response is less than 10ms, up to 100Mb/s with
On communication bandwidth can satisfy automation track crane system control signal bandwidth require and video transmission bandwidth requirement.
It, can be with real-time detection DC output voltage, electric current, power grid in the track crane DC power-supply system that the application proposes
The parameters such as input voltage, temperature have the defencive functions such as over-voltage, overcurrent, under-voltage, insulation, filtering to system;The embodiment of the present application
In, direct current of ground power supply unit 13 further includes power supply management module 133, excellent for carrying out current working track crane job instruction
First grade sequence, executes current working track crane job instruction according to priority ranking;And exceed in the workload of track crane
When rated load, the track crane job instruction delayed execution of low priority is controlled, namely, it is ensured that the operation function being currently running
The sum of rate is no more than the rated load of track crane DC power-supply system, can reduce system coincidence factor to greatest extent,
The installed capacity for reducing whole system is realized and is powered using lesser direct current installed capacity to more track cranes, saved
Installation cost.
The track crane DC power-supply system that the application proposes further includes energy feedback module 16;The energy feedback module 16 is used
In the direct current for capableing of feedback for collecting the energy generated in track crane operation namely track crane generation, through current-collector and wiping
The inverter for including in device and direct current of ground power supply, is fed back to power grid;Power supply management module 133 is then controlled and will be generated
The track crane job instruction of energy feedback combines execution with the track crane job instruction that can not generate energy feedback, avoids feeding
Track crane operation be individually performed, guarantee that track crane can be to greatest extent using other tracks in track crane itself or homologous ray
The electric energy of feedback is hung, to save the power grid energy, also promotes the direct current supply ability for improving this system.

Cart, trolley, the raising operating mechanism of track crane take electricity when accelerating and traveling at the uniform speed from DC power-supply system,
In deceleration and lifting mechanism decline operation to DC power-supply system feedback electric energy, therefore, the track crane direct current in the application is supplied
Electric system, use will generate the track crane job instruction of energy feedback and can not generate the track crane operation of energy feedback
The mode that instructing combination executes, avoids the track crane job instruction that can generate energy feedback from being individually performed, also avoids back
The waste of energy regenerative amount guarantees that track crane can use system feedback to greatest extent so that feedback energy is applied to current working
Electric energy, saved the power grid energy.
The direct current supply side in track crane DC power-supply system the application proposed with a specific embodiment below
Method is described in detail.
Assuming that the cart of 8 track cranes in every set track crane DC power-supply system, raising, trolley are different in a certain period
The different operating condition of operating status composition whole system, there is different power demands in each mechanism under different loads;Such as
Relatively common operating condition: 8 track cranes of 4 heap blocks have 4 carts to accelerate work simultaneously, have 2 cart steady operations, there is 2
Platform raising is in unloaded operation, and among these, cart peak power is 849KW and steady state power is 343KW, peak when raising zero load
Value power is 464KW and steady state power is 376KW, and auxiliary body's power is 20KW, then can calculate 8 track cranes most
It is high-power are as follows:
Pg=(849+20)*4+(343+20)*2+(464+20)*2=5170KW ;Calculate the steady state power of 8 track cranes are as follows: Pw=
(343+20)*4+(343+20)*2+(376+20)*2=2970KW。
TOS(Terminal Operating System) by track crane job instruction be first sent to track crane DC power-supply system for fulgurite
Module is managed, track crane job instruction refers to an instruction sequence group, when one group of instruction execution, power supply management module 1) it can basis
Instruction sequences control the response time that 8 track cranes execute the instruction of respective rail crane operations, 2) by current 8 tracks crane operation work
The job instruction for the mechanism for needing to run in condition optimizes combination according to priority, 3) control first carry out that priority is high (can be with
According to handling ship instruction highest, transmitting-receiving case instruction are taken second place, stockyard varus smashes and instructs minimum principle) track crane mechanism action refer to
Enable, 4) time that track crane executing agency acts is controlled according to priority, guarantee the sum of mechanism power being currently running
No more than the rated load that DC power-supply system allows, such as exceed rated load, then controls the low job instruction delay of priority
It executes;5) control will generate the track crane job instruction of energy feedback and can not generate the track crane operation of energy feedback
Instructing combination executes;In 4 heap blocks, 8 track cranes in a set of track crane DC power-supply system, when wherein several track loop wheel machines
Structure is in energy feedback state when being in deceleration or lifting mechanism decline state, the feedback electric energy of generation can be by public straight
It flows bus to use for other track crane mechanisms, so as to reduce the installation general power of direct current of ground power supply unit, reduces installation
Capacity, and guarantee the electric energy that can use other track crane feedbacks when certain track crane operation to greatest extent, to reduce
The installation general power of DC power-supply system.
The coincidence factor referring to shown in following table one calculates, and the track crane direct current supply method proposed according to the application is excellent
It is 0.65 that 8 track cranes after change, which select coincidence factor:
Table one
Track crane quantity | 1 | 2 | 3 | 4 | 5 | 6 | 7 | 8 | 9 | 10 |
Coincidence factor | 1 | 0.95 | 0.91 | 0.87 | 0.84 | 0.81 | 0.78 | 0.75 | 0.72 | 0.69 |
Track crane DC power-supply system | 1 | 0.92 | 0.87 | 0.83 | 0.78 | 0.74 | 0.69 | 0.65 | 0.60 | 0.56 |
Then calculate the installation general power of the direct current of ground power supply unit of track crane DC power-supply system are as follows:
P=Pg*0.65=5170*0.65=3360KW。
